North Carolina Governor Vetoes Invoice Increasing Non-public College Vouchers

North Carolina Gov. Roy Cooper has vetoed a invoice that will have considerably expanded investment for personal faculty vouchers and mandated native sheriffs’ cooperation with federal immigration government on detaining unlawful immigrants.

Cooper, who has persistently antagonistic the growth of personal faculty vouchers, introduced on Sept. 20 that he had vetoed Area Invoice 10, a measure handed on Sept. 9 by means of the Republican-led state Legislature and praised by means of advocates of faculty selection.

The handed model of Area Invoice 10 that Cooper vetoed on Friday referred to as for $248 million in nonrecurring budget to totally fund the waitlist for Alternative Scholarships, which give monetary help for college students attending non-public faculties. Moreover, the invoice allotted $215 million in routine budget to proceed supporting this system for long run fiscal years.

The invoice additionally incorporated quite a lot of price range changes, further investment for particular wishes systems, provisions to give a boost to broadband get right of entry to in rural spaces, in addition to a mandate for native sheriffs to carry noncitizens charged with explicit crimes for 48 hours and notify U.S. Immigration and Customs Enforcement (ICE).

Cooper made his objections to non-public faculty vouchers transparent all through a press convention on Friday, by which he argued that the invoice would hurt rural public faculties specifically.

“This invoice takes public taxpayer bucks from the general public faculties and provides it to non-public faculty vouchers that might be utilized by rich households,“ he stated. ”All public faculties might be harm by means of the legislature losing its deliberate $4 billion of the general public’s cash over the following decade with rural public faculties being harm the worst.

“This cash will have to be used to strengthen our public faculties by means of elevating trainer pay and making an investment in public faculty scholars. Due to this fact, I veto the invoice.”

Mike Lengthy, president of the college selection advocacy Folks for Instructional Freedom in North Carolina, hastily replied to the veto, protecting the Alternative Scholarship Program and calling for an override of the veto by means of the state’s Common Meeting.

“Make no mistake about it, North Carolina Governor Roy Cooper has been antagonistic to the Alternative Scholarship Program since day one,” Lengthy stated in a observation. “Whilst Governor Cooper continues to face antagonistic to parental faculty selection calling the Alternative Scholarship Program a ‘scheme’ we all know firsthand that tens of hundreds of households in our state have benefited from this program.”

Republicans within the North Carolina Common Meeting be capable of override Cooper’s veto as a result of they recently hang a supermajority.

The vetoed invoice additionally incorporated a number of provisions relating to native regulation enforcement cooperation with ICE. The invoice stipulates that, upon receiving an ICE detainer and administrative warrant for an unlawful immigrant charged with positive crimes, sheriffs should hang such folks in custody for as much as 48 hours or till ICE takes custody, whichever comes first.

Additionally, when native regulation enforcement is not able to decide whether or not an individual charged with positive crimes is a criminal resident of america, the invoice calls for regulation enforcement to question ICE to ensure the person’s immigration standing. Additional, the invoice shields native regulation enforcement companies and officials from prison and civil legal responsibility for movements taken in compliance with the ICE detainer and administrative warrant procedure.

Critics of those provisions have argued that they’d pressure family members between regulation enforcement and immigrant communities. This argument, additionally raised by means of warring parties of an identical regulation in other places within the nation, rests at the perception that imposing immigration detainers may undermine agree with between regulation enforcement and immigrant communities, making the ones communities much less more likely to file crimes and cooperate with police.

Republicans in North Carolina were seeking to move a invoice requiring sheriffs to cooperate with ICE since 2019 however have been vetoed by means of Cooper in 2019 and once more in 2022.
